Offset printers prepare and run offset presses that transfer inked images from printing plates to rubber blankets and then onto paper or another surface.
In job descriptions, look for press setup, prepress proofs, printing forms, ink rollers, paper types, test runs, colour mixtures, production schedules and output inspection.
Work centres on preparing the press, loading materials, checking proofs and keeping ink, plate, blanket and paper settings stable through the run.
Useful depth includes offset printing, prepress proofs, paper types, printing forms, ink rollers, colour mixtures, machine controls and inspection of printed output.
Pay context is shaped by press size, shift pattern, colour and registration demands, maintenance duties, chemical handling and responsibility for waste or defective materials.
Experience can lead to senior press operator, print production coordination, prepress support, quality control, machine maintenance or other printing techniques.
Check whether the advert names sheet-fed or web offset, paper format, colour work, proofing responsibility, cleaning routines and production-record requirements.
